M Hafidh Bahrul Mau'idho - Junior Software Engineer Grade 2 - PT PLN Icon Plus | Himalayas
M Hafidh Bahrul Mau'idhoMM
Open to opportunities

M Hafidh Bahrul Mau'idho

@idho

Java Software Engineer with 3+ years of backend development experience.

Indonesia
Message

What I'm looking for

I am looking for a role that fosters collaboration, encourages innovation, and offers opportunities for professional growth.

I am a Java Software Engineer with over three years of experience in building and maintaining backend systems using Java Spring Boot. My expertise lies in designing RESTful APIs, improving system performance, and translating business needs into technical solutions. I thrive in collaborative environments, working across teams to solve problems and enhance product reliability.

In my current role as a Junior Software Engineer at PT PLN Icon Plus, I have developed scalable and reliable backend systems, optimized system performance, and integrated various services. My contributions include building REST APIs for applications such as the New ITO TUS Bung Online and Home Charging services, as well as participating in a Proof of Concept session with IBM to evaluate API management solutions.

With a commitment to writing maintainable and testable code, I ensure that my work aligns with clear project requirements. I am passionate about leveraging technology to create impactful solutions and am eager to take on new challenges in my career.

Experience

Work history, roles, and key accomplishments

PP

Junior Software Engineer Grade 2

PT PLN Icon Plus

Jul 2022 - Jun 2025 (2 years 11 months)

As a Backend Java Engineer, I was responsible for developing and maintaining scalable and reliable backend systems using Java Spring Boot. My work included building REST APIs, optimizing system performance, integrating with various services, and collaborating across teams in product development.

Education

Degrees, certifications, and relevant coursework

STIKI MALANG logoSM

STIKI MALANG

Bachelor of Computer Science, Informatics Engineering

Studied computer science principles and practices. Gained expertise in software development and system design.

Interested in hiring M Hafidh Bahrul?

You can contact M Hafidh Bahrul and 90k+ other talented remote workers on Himalayas.

Message M Hafidh Bahrul

People also viewed

View all talent

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an